What is a Hopper Feeder Conveyor?

Time:2025-10-16 14:46:59 Number of Clicks:

hopper feeder conveyor, also known as a Grasshopper Conveyor, Portable Stacker, or Jump Conveyor, is a bulk material handling equipment integrating "material receiving, quantitative conveying, and flexible movement". Its core function is to uniformly convey bulk materials (such as ores, coal, cement, aggregates, etc.) received by the hopper to subsequent conveying equipment (such as belt conveyors, mobile ship loaders, etc.) at a preset speed or flow rate. At the same time, it can flexibly adjust its position according to operational needs to avoid material accumulation and blockage, ensuring the continuous operation of the production line.

Structure of the Hopper Feeder Conveyor

In terms of structural design, ZOOMRY's hopper feeder conveyor mainly consists of five core components, which work together to meet the needs of different industries worldwide:

  • Receiving Hopper: Adopts an ultra-low design and is made of high-strength carbon steel or wear-resistant alloy. The inner wall's wear-resistant layer can be customized according to material properties (such as hardness, corrosiveness). Meanwhile, it offers customized designs with widths ranging from 3.5m to 5.7m to ensure smooth material unloading and avoid spillage and loss during the unloading process. It is suitable for the unloading needs of different types of trucks, wheel loaders, or excavators.
  • Conveying Mechanism: Takes belt conveying as the core, equipped with a high-wear-resistant conveyor belt and a precise tensioning system. The conveying length can be customized from 15m to 30m according to needs, and it supports cascading of multiple devices to meet the material transfer requirements of short distances and multiple locations.
  • Drive System: Provides two options: wheel-type and tracked. The wheel-type chassis adopts a reinforced solid structure, suitable for most flat sites; the tracked chassis can easily handle rough terrain, enabling all-terrain mobile operations without the need for complex foundation construction.
  • Control System: Standardly equipped with PLC full-automatic control and an HMI touch screen, supporting remote control and manual switching. It can real-time monitor parameters such as conveying speed and material level height. At the same time, it has overload protection and emergency stop functions to ensure the safe operation of the equipment.
  • Safety and Auxiliary Components: Include rubber skirts (to prevent material side leakage), grid screens (to filter large impurities), dust covers (to reduce dust pollution), and hydraulic jacks (for equipment positioning and leveling), fully complying with international safety standards.

Core Functions of the Hopper Feeder Conveyor

In bulk material handling scenarios, traditional fixed conveying equipment often faces problems such as "poor site adaptability", "low material transfer efficiency", and "high labor costs". The hopper feeder conveyor (grasshopper conveyor) accurately solves these pain points through targeted design, and its core functions can be summarized into the following five points:

  • Multi-Terrain Adaptability: The wheel-type chassis is suitable for flat sites such as ports and factories, allowing quick transfer of operation points; the tracked chassis can stably travel on rough terrain such as mines and quarries without the need for pre-laid tracks or site leveling, significantly reducing initial investment.
  • Efficient Collaboration: The ultra-low hopper can directly meet the unloading needs of loaders and excavators, avoiding material spillage during transfer; the conveying speed and flow rate can be precisely adjusted through the control system to ensure stable material supply for subsequent equipment (such as radial stackers and mobile ship loaders), preventing overload or insufficient supply.
  • Small Space Occupation: The foldable boom design reduces the space occupied by the equipment by more than 40% when idle, especially suitable for operation environments with limited space; the customized conveying length of 15-30m can directly connect different production links, reducing the number of round-trip truck transfers and increasing overall operational efficiency by more than 30%.
  • Multi-Scenario Adaptability: Whether it is ore transfer in sand and gravel quarries, raw material deployment in aggregate plants, or material handling in fly ash remediation projects, the equipment can adapt to the needs of different scenarios through power selection (diesel/electricity) and boom length adjustment, and can be put into use without additional modifications.

Stable Feeding Collaboration with Belt Conveyors

ZOOMRY's belt conveyors cover various types such as long-distance ground conveyors, pipe belt conveyors, and large-inclination belt conveyors, which are widely used in large-scale bulk material transfer in industries such as mining, chemical engineering, and power plants. The collaboration between hopper feeder conveyors and belt conveyors mainly solves the pain point of "easy overload due to uneven feeding" of belt conveyors. After receiving materials unloaded by loaders and trucks through its own ultra-low receiving hopper, the hopper feeder conveyor controls the conveying volume error within ±5% by virtue of the PLC control system, and feeds materials to the belt conveyor at a constant flow rate. This prevents belt deviation and motor overload of the belt conveyor caused by a sudden increase in materials, or idling waste caused by material interruption.

For example, in mine long-distance bulk material conveying projects, ZOOMRY's hopper feeder conveyor can be directly deployed between crushing equipment and belt conveyors to uniformly convey crushed ores to belt conveyors. Cooperating with the large conveying capacity of belt conveyors (up to 2100m³/h), it forms a continuous process of "crushing - feeding - long-distance transfer". Cascading Expansion Application of Multiple Hopper Feeder Conveyors

ZOOMRY's hopper feeder conveyor (grasshopper conveyor) itself has the characteristics of "modular design and flexible length adjustment", supporting customized conveying lengths of 15-30m and a foldable boom structure. When multiple devices are used in cascading, they can break through the conveying distance limit of a single device and form a flexible conveying chain of "multi-point receiving and long-distance transfer", which is especially suitable for large-area operation scenarios such as quarries and mines.

The core advantages of cascading multiple hopper feeder conveyors are: ① Distance expansion: By connecting 2-3 devices in series, the conveying distance can be extended to 60-90m to meet the needs of long-distance cross-regional transfer. Each device can independently adjust the angle and speed to ensure smooth material transfer; ② Multi-point adaptation: Each device can correspond to one unloading point (such as multiple loaders unloading at the same time), and the materials are collected to the same terminal (such as belt conveyors, stacking areas) through cascading to avoid single-point congestion; ③ Scenario flexibility: The cascading devices can choose diesel or electric drive according to site needs. Even in remote areas without electricity, they can operate independently with self-contained generator sets. In addition, the equipment can be disassembled and packed into 40"HQ containers, facilitating global transportation and on-site rapid assembly (installation can be completed in 10-20 days).

For example, in large aggregate plants, 3 hopper feeder conveyors are deployed in cascading to receive aggregate unloading from different mining points respectively. Through cascading, the aggregates are transferred to the central crushing area. Cooperating with the tracked chassis of each device, the position can be adjusted at any time to adapt to the mining progress, significantly improving the efficiency of aggregate collection and transfer.


Global Application Scenarios of Hopper Feeder Conveyors

Mining Quarries and Aggregate Plants

The operation sites of sand and gravel quarries and aggregate plants are mostly open-air and rough, and materials need to be transferred between multiple mining points and crushing points. ZOOMRY's tracked hopper feeder conveyor (grasshopper conveyor) can be directly deployed on-site. It receives materials unloaded by excavators through the ultra-low hopper and then conveys the materials to crushing equipment or radial stackers. Its tracked chassis can withstand the gravel terrain in quarries, avoiding equipment getting stuck or damaged, and ensuring continuous material transfer.

Bulk Material Handling at Ports and Terminals

In bulk material transfer scenarios at ports and factories, the site is relatively flat but the operation position needs to be adjusted frequently. ZOOMRY's wheel-type hopper feeder conveyor (grasshopper conveyor) can be quickly transferred through solid tires to connect trucks, ship unloaders, and belt conveyors. Its foldable boom reduces space occupation when idle, which is especially suitable for the operation needs of "limited space and efficiency priority" at ports and terminals, helping to speed up cargo turnover.

Chemical and Building Materials Industries

Raw materials in the chemical industry (such as chemical fertilizers and soda ash) or aggregates in the building materials industry (such as cement and sand) have high requirements for "sealing performance" and "cleanliness" during the conveying process. ZOOMRY's hopper feeder conveyor can be equipped with a fully sealed hopper and dust cover design to prevent materials from getting damp or contaminated. At the same time, according to the corrosiveness of materials, it uses HDPE or stainless steel liners to ensure long-term stable operation of the equipment, complying with the strict standards of the chemical industry.

Power and Energy Industries

Thermal power plants and biomass energy plants need to continuously convey fuels (such as coal and biomass pellets) to boilers. Once the material supply is interrupted, it will directly affect the power generation efficiency. ZOOMRY's hopper feeder conveyor is equipped with a highly sensitive material level sensor, which can real-time monitor the material stock in the hopper and automatically send a material replenishment signal when the material is insufficient. At the same time, it has an overload protection function to avoid equipment jamming caused by fuel agglomeration, ensuring the 24-hour continuous operation of the power plant.

Key Considerations for Choosing a Hopper Feeder Conveyor

For global customers, choosing a suitable hopper feeder conveyor (grasshopper conveyor) needs to be combined with their own operation scenarios and long-term needs to avoid inefficiency or cost waste caused by insufficient equipment adaptability:

  • Operational Terrain: For flat sites (such as ports and factories), prioritize the wheel-type chassis; for rough terrain (such as mines and quarries), choose the tracked chassis to ensure the mobile stability of the equipment;
  • Material Characteristics: According to the material particle size (such as fine powder, large ore) and humidity (such as wet coal, dry sand), decide whether to configure a wear-resistant liner or dust cover to avoid equipment wear or material contamination;
  • Conveying Needs: Clarify the conveying length (15-30m optional) and handling capacity. For small projects (such as fly ash remediation), choose short-arm models with 15-20m; for large quarries, long-arm models with 25-30m are needed to support cascading use;
  • Power Conditions: Choose electric drive for sites with stable power supply; choose diesel drive (equipped with generator sets) for areas without electricity or remote areas;
